The moment of inertia of a thin circular disc about an axis passing through its centre and perpendicular to its plane is I. Then the moment of Inertia of the disc about an axis parallel to its diameter and touching the edge of the rim is

Options

(a) I
(b) 2I
(c) 3I / 2
(d) 5I / 2

Correct Answer:

5I / 2
